** The Lexus repair market for Briggs, Texas, is effectively an extension of the highly competitive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ex. As a small community, Briggs itself does not host dedicated Lexus-only specialists. Residents primarily rely on the high-density of service options in neighboring cities like Grapevine, Southlake, and Keller. The market is bifurcated: on one hand, you have the factory-backed dealerships (Sewell, Park Place) which offer the highest level of brand-specific expertise, cutting-edge tools, and OEM parts, but at a premium price. On the other hand, a select number of elite independent shops (like European Auto Garage) cater to owners seeking dealer-level quality with more personalized service and often lower labor rates. The overall quality is very high due to the competitive and affluent nature of the region. Pricing is typical for a major metropolitan area, with dealerships commanding top dollar and independents offering a 15-30% cost savings on labor. For complex systems like hybrid batteries or air suspension, the dealerships often have a slight edge in direct experience and proprietary diagnostic software.
